Definition of omnivorous adjective from the Oxford Advanced Learner's Dictionary

omnivorous

adjective
 
/ɒmˈnɪvərəs/
 
/ɑːmˈnɪvərəs/
jump to other results
  1. eating all types of food, especially both plants and meat compare carnivorous, herbivorous
  2. having wide interests in a particular area or activity
    • She has always been an omnivorous reader.
  3. Word Originmid 17th cent.: from Latin omnivorus + -ous.
